In Roanoke, prized vintage cards include classics such as the Honus Wagner T206 and the 1952 Topps Mickey Mantle, as well as 1933 Goudey and early Babe Ruth cards. Many collectors prioritize rookie cards from Hall of Famers and graded vintage cards certified by trusted grading companies. Rare inserts and unique card variants also generate local interest.
Collectors in Roanoke consider multiple factors including the condition of the card, professional grading certification (PSA and Beckett), rarity, and the historical significance tied to the player or card series. Demand for specific players and recent market sales impact card values locally and nationwide.
